Expansion cards and backup units
9.4.2.2 Removing an SFP+ transceiver module
For Fiber Channel over Ethernet (FCoE) configurations, the ethernet server
adapter is equipped with one or two SFP+ (small form-factor pluggable)
transceiver modules.
Figure 114: Removing the protective optical port plug
Ê If present, remove the protective optical port plug from the SFP+ transceiver
module.
V CAUTION!
Save the protective port plug for future use.
Customer Replaceable Unit
(CRU)
Hardware: 10 minutes
Tools: tool-less
